Where: Staffordshire, United Kingdom (52.6° N, 2.1° W: paleocoordinates 0.5° S, 8.1° E)
• coordinate based on nearby landmark
• outcrop-level geographic resolution
When: Westphalian B (316.9 - 314.6 Ma)
• Middle Coal Measures (binds between the "Brooch" and "Thick" coals). Westphalian B, Duckmantian, according to recent papers.
• group of beds-level stratigraphic resolution
Environment/lithology: interdistributary bay; lithified, nodular, sideritic shale
Size class: macrofossils
Preservation: mold/impression
Reposited in the BMNH
